Trying to understand NFC ASK Modulation

BigG
BigG over 2 years ago

According to my Google search, NFC uses ASK modulation to transmit data:

https://www.rfwireless-world.com/Tutorials/NFC-Near-Field-Communication-tutorial.html

https://www.rfwireless-world.com/Tutorials/NFC-Modulation-and-NFC-Coding.html

Which I have interpreted as the following where the "Mixing Circuit" includes the NFC tuned antenna and two picoFarad capacitors... but what else is needed.

image

As a non electronics engineer I am trying to work out a minimum circuit required.

Then my lofty intentions is to use a Raspberry Pi Pico to generate my clock signal using PIO and as there is also a Manchester Encoding PIO example, I will attempt to use that too.

So could this work, I wonder?

    Agree, unfortunately this is a project that's very unlikely to work, because there's several hurdles here; not just the hardware design and building of the receiver, but also the decoding complexity, it won't be a nice friendly stream of usable data all the time either, there will be noise to deal with so it needs some signal processing as well (can be partially in hardware and partially in software). It's all a major project, not a weekend thing. 

    If the Pico can be replaced with a PC and sound card, then that could make life easier to better understand the challenge and implement on the PC first perhaps, rather than coding for the Pico initially. But the signal would need to be mixed down to see it (e.g. with any SDR project hardware).
